Just Join the List a few days ago I have been collecting a few Drake twins 
and wanted to get the cabinets refinished like they were original I contacted 
Hartzell in Miamsburg Ohio, Who originally did the cabinet Paint for drake 
the cabinets came Back like New, I also asked them if they could match some 
Icom cabinets, I sent in my 761 cabinet and they match it perfect along with 
same type finish also they matched the ps30 power supply paint also. The cost 
for most cabinets 25.00 larger radios like IC 761 maybe 55.00 Just to put it 
into perspective a new cabinet if still available from Icom will run 375.00. 
Matching paint has some additional cost but if they have done the matching 
work for previous customer you will not have that additional charge, also 
there very quick, I just had 7 cabinets restored 175.00 Total and they were 
return each wrapped and bubbled with cardboard. and shipping was included.  I 
Know I have been frustrated in trying to restore an older Icom radio and not 
being able to get a good match or correct finish. 

Right Now Hartzell can Match all 761 and 765 , 9000 , 781 radios 775 that 
light Bronze Finish. Also they have the paint match for the PS30,AT500 and 2 
KL amp at100 .
